A well-established manufacturer in the UK is seeking a Controls Systems Engineer to develop and modify PLC-based software for bespoke machinery. The ideal candidate will have an HNC/Degree in Engineering, along with proficiency in PLC and HMI systems.

This role offers a competitive salary, flexible working hours, and comprehensive benefits including 25 days annual leave and private medical cover. If you’re looking for a dynamic engineering environment, this is your opportunity.

How to prepare for a job interview at White Label Recruitment Ltd

✨Know Your PLCs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of PLC and HMI systems before the interview. Be ready to discuss specific projects where you've developed or modified PLC-based software, as this will show your hands-on experience and expertise.

✨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ills

Prepare to share examples of how you've tackled challenges in previous roles. Think about situations where you had to troubleshoot or optimise a control system, and be ready to explain your thought process and the outcomes.

✨Understand the Company’s Products

Research the manufacturer’s machinery and products. Knowing what they produce and how your role as a Controls Systems Engineer fits into their operations will demonstrate your genuine interest and help you stand out.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are some thoughtful questions to ask at the end of the interview. This could be about their engineering processes, team dynamics, or future projects. It shows you're engaged and eager to contribute to their dynamic environment.
